Natural (Bio-based) Resin Market Wettbewerbslandschaft

The competitive landscape is led by global specialty chemical companies and a smaller group of focused bio-based resin developers. Market competition is based on product performance, bio-content verification, supply reliability, application support, and pricing. Large players benefit from global distribution and downstream customer relationships, while specialized firms compete through innovation and sustainability positioning.

Preisanalyse

Average pricing is gradually improving as buyers accept a premium for verified renewable content, lower emissions, and specialty performance. Prices remain sensitive to feedstock costs and formulation complexity, especially in high-performance epoxy and polyurethane grades.

Kostenkomponente Anteil (%)
Bio-based feedstock procurement 34%
Verarbeitung und Konvertierung 22%
Arbeits- und Anlagenbetrieb 16%
Qualitätsprüfung und Zertifizierung 14%
Logistik, Verpackung und Gemeinkosten 14%

Typical gross margins range from 14% to 26%, with higher margins in specialty epoxy and formulation-heavy products. Commodity-like grades face stronger price pressure, while certified and application-specific products support better profitability.

Marktdynamik

Drivers
  • Rising demand for low-carbon and renewable industrial materials
  • Stronger regulations on emissions, VOC content, and sustainability disclosure
  • Growth in green packaging, coatings, and composite applications
  • Brand owner pressure to improve recyclability and bio-based content
Restraints
  • Higher production cost than conventional petroleum-based resins
  • Feedstock availability can vary by region and season
  • Performance trade-offs in some high-heat or high-load applications
  • Limited processing familiarity among smaller downstream buyers
Opportunities
  • Expansion of bio-based resins in packaging adhesives and protective coatings
  • Use in automotive interior parts and lightweight composite structures
  • Product development for higher-performance and partially bio-based formulations
  • Long-term supply agreements with consumer goods and industrial manufacturers
Challenges
  • Scaling consistent quality across diverse biomass inputs
  • Meeting price-sensitive buyer requirements while protecting margins
  • Building end-user confidence through performance validation
  • Competing with established petrochemical resin supply chains
